Searched refs:extractComponents (Results 1 – 2 of 2) sorted by relevance
/external/angle/src/compiler/translator/tree_ops/glsl/ |
D | ScalarizeVecAndMatConstructorArgs.cpp | 87 void extractComponents(const TFunction *helper, 243 void ScalarizeTraverser::extractComponents(const TFunction *helper, in extractComponents() function in sh::__anon0e4726bd0111::ScalarizeTraverser 313 extractComponents(helper, node->getType().getNominalSize(), constructorArgsOut); in createConstructorVectorFromMultiple() 347 extractComponents(helper, type.getCols() * type.getRows(), constructorArgsOut); in createConstructorMatrixFromVectors()
|
/external/angle/src/compiler/translator/spirv/ |
D | OutputSPIRV.cpp | 289 void extractComponents(TIntermAggregate *node, 1559 extractComponents(node, node->getType().getNominalSize(), parameters, &extractedComponents); in createConstructorVectorFromMatrix() 1596 extractComponents(node, type.getNominalSize(), parameters, &extractedComponents); in createConstructorVectorFromMultiple() 1725 extractComponents(node, type.getCols() * type.getRows(), parameters, &extractedComponents); in createConstructorMatrixFromVectors() 1908 void OutputSPIRVTraverser::extractComponents(TIntermAggregate *node, in extractComponents() function in sh::__anon2afe1e900111::OutputSPIRVTraverser
|